Eligibility Criteria for the Application for Arms License
To apply for an arms license, applicants must meet specific eligibility requirements, including:
-
Minimum age requirement, typically 21 years.
-
Residency in Tamil Nadu and proof of address.
-
Background checks to assess criminal history and mental health status.
-
Possession of relevant training or qualifications in firearm use.
Required Documents and Supporting Materials
When submitting an application for an arms license, applicants must provide several essential documents, including:
-
Identity proof such as an Aadhar card or passport.
-
Address proof like utility bills or rental agreements.
-
Any required certificates or forms specific to arms licensing.
It is crucial to ensure that all documentation is accurate and complete to avoid delays in processing.

What are the eligibility requirements to apply for an Arms License in Tamil Nadu?
To apply for an Arms License in Tamil Nadu, you must be a legal resident, typically over 21 years of age, and meet specific background checks regarding your criminal history.
Is there a deadline for submitting the Application for Arms License?
Generally, there is no strict deadline for applying for an Arms License. However, it is advisable to submit your application as soon as possible to avoid delays in processing.
How should I submit my completed Arms License application?
You can submit your completed Arms License application either in-person at the police station designated for license approvals or through the electronic submission options provided, if available.
What supporting documents are required with the application?
Required supporting documents typically include identity proof, address proof, a reference from a reputable citizen, and details about the firearms you wish to have.
What are some common mistakes to avoid when filling out the Arms License application?
Common mistakes include leaving fields blank, providing incorrect information about your criminal history, and failing to attach necessary supporting documents.
How long does it take to process an Arms License application?
The processing time for an Arms License application can vary, but it typically takes several weeks, depending on thorough background checks and the completeness of your application.
